EPA v. TOWN OF BROOKLINE - JACK KIRRANE SKATING RINK
Case summary
On December 28, 2018, Region 1 executed and filed a Notice of Violation and Administrative Consent Order (ACO) that requires the Town of Brookline to conduct a Process Hazard Review of its rink's ice-making system in accordance with the first duty of the General Duty Clause, found at CAA Section 112(r)(1). Brookline has agreed to the ACO and executed the agreement on December 18, 2018. Once Brookline started its hazard review process, it found several safety improvements that it should make, which are listed in the ACO. Region 1 undertook this action after an ammonia release occurred at the rink. This action is part of the National Compliance Initiative for Chemical Accident Risk Reduction. Also, certain General Duty Clause actions require approval by the Assistant Administrator for OECA.
